Letter Format and Structure

A professional letter needs specific elements to show your skills:

  • Clean, legible handwriting or typed format
  • Proper margins and spacing
  • Clear, concise language
  • Organized paragraphs with logical flow

Professional Greeting and Closing

How you address your teacher sets the tone for your message. Consider these tips:

  1. Use appropriate salutations like “Dear [Teacher’s Name]”
  2. Choose a respectful closing such as “Sincerely” or “Respectfully”
  3. Sign your full name

Why is writing a letter to my teacher important?

Writing to your teacher builds positive relationships and improves communication skills. It shows maturity and respect, which is valuable in academic settings. This practice also provides a professional way to express thoughts, concerns, or gratitude.

What should I include in a letter to my teacher?

Your letter needs a clear purpose, professional greeting, and concise body explaining your message. Be specific about why you’re writing, whether it’s for help or appreciation. Always proofread for clarity and correct grammar.

How formal should my letter be?

The formality depends on your school’s culture and your relationship with the teacher. Start with “Dear [Mr./Ms./Mrs.] [Last Name]” for the first communication. If you know the teacher well, you can be slightly less formal.

What are common mistakes to avoid when writing a letter to a teacher?

Avoid using informal language, being too emotional, or lacking clarity. Don’t use text speak, slang, or overly casual language. Be direct and respectful in your writing.Make sure your letter is neat, well-organized, and free of spelling errors. Proofread carefully to catch any mistakes before sending.

How long should my letter to a teacher be?

Keep your letter between 250-500 words. Be clear and to the point. Focus on your main message without unnecessary details.For complex issues, provide enough context while keeping the letter readable and engaging.

Can I email my teacher instead of writing a physical letter?

Many schools accept email communication, but treat it like a formal letter. Use a professional email address and have a clear subject line. Maintain the same level of respect as you would in a written letter.Some teachers may prefer traditional written communication. Check your school’s preferred method before sending.

What if I’m nervous about writing a letter to my teacher?

It’s okay to feel nervous. Start by drafting a rough copy, then revise it. Use a clear, calm tone and focus on being honest and respectful.Ask a parent, guardian, or trusted friend to review your letter before sending. Teachers appreciate students who communicate clearly and professionally.
